All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.soento.core.lang.BaseQuery Maven / Gradle / Ivy

package com.soento.core.lang;

import java.util.List;

/**
 * @author yantao.zeng
 */
public abstract class BaseQuery extends BaseObject {
    private static final long serialVersionUID = -8813423753102466269L;
    /**
     * 分页
     */
    private Pagination pagination;
    /**
     * 排序
     */
    private List sorters;
    /**
     * 条件过滤
     */
    private List filters;

    public BaseQuery() {
        this.pagination = new Pagination();
    }

    public Pagination getPagination() {
        return pagination;
    }

    public void setPagination(Pagination pagination) {
        this.pagination = pagination;
    }

    public List getSorters() {
        return sorters;
    }

    public void setSorters(List sorters) {
        this.sorters = sorters;
    }

    public List getFilters() {
        return filters;
    }

    public void setFilters(List filters) {
        this.filters = filters;
    }
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y